You need to have cfd.lha and fat95.lha from aminet and configure them properly.

CC0: is not suitable for anything but ancient SRAM cards when formatted to use as storage. Won't work with SD/CF.


You may already know this but, Kickstart 2.05 (V37.350) is recommended if you wish to use larger hard drives or CF cards in an A600.
